More companies have unveiled a special dividend or accelerated dividend payout, as they seek to avoid potentially higher taxes next year amid heated "fiscal cliff" deliberations in Washington.In January, $500 billion in automatic tax increases and spending cuts--dubbed the "fiscal cliff"--will begin if Congress and the White House don't intervene. Dozens of companies already have moved their quarterly dividend payouts to December instead of early 2013 to avoid possible higher taxes, while others have approved one-time special dividend payments for December.On Thursday, Sirius XM Radio Inc. (SIRI) declared a special dividend of five cents a share, payable Dec. 28. The cost is expected to be about $325 million.The satellite-radio operator also approved a stock buyback program of $2 billion. The company's market value is about $14.42 billion, according to FactSet.Transportation services firm Landstar System Inc.
